On one of my fishing trips with a good friend, Lee Harris, I learned a
valuable lesson about fishing and retirement. We were headed to a local lake
to do some trout fishing. I advised Lee that we had to hurry to get to the lake
to get a good spot to fish. Lee turned to me and said, "Richard, we are retired.
We do not have to hurry to do anything." We got to the lake and each caught
a limit of trout. It was a great day of fishing and I learned the true value of
being retired and fishing with good friends.
